With Joffrey dead, Lena Headey stepped into the spotlight as a grieving, vengeful mother. Season 4 allowed Headey to show Cersei’s vulnerability for the first time, particularly in her scenes with Tywin and Tyrion, while simultaneously cementing her role as the show’s primary antagonist. The fourth season of Game of Thrones , which aired in 2014, featured one of the series' most extensive ensemble casts, bolstered by several major promotions to the main roster and the introduction of iconic new characters.
